Gazzin.com to Upgrade Reseller Hosting Services
Established in 2004, Gazzin.com has become a leader in reseller hosting. In a recent announcement, the company plans to implement upgrades that will affect the infrastructure, reseller hosting plans and other product offerings. These changes have been in the works for several months and will take effect in the near future.Categories: Reseller Web Hosting |
